Migrating from Cartoon Network to the upcoming streaming service HBO Max, the series will see a bit of a rebrand, now being called Adventure Time: Distant Lands. The series will consist of four hour-long episodes, and HBO has even gone and shared not only the episode titles, but also their stories!

“‘BMO’ follows the lovable little robot from Adventure Time. When there’s a deadly space emergency in the farthest reaches of the galaxy, there’s only one hero to call, and it’s probably not BMO. Except that this time it is!

“‘Obsidian’ features Marceline & Princess Bubblegum as they journey to the imposing, beautiful Glass Kingdom—and deep into their tumultuous past—to prevent an earthshaking catastrophe.

“‘Wizard City follows Peppermint Butler, starting over at the beginning, as just another inexperienced Wizard School student. When mysterious events at the campus cast suspicion on Pep, and his checkered past, can he master the mystic arts in time to prove his innocence?

“‘Together Again brings Finn and Jake together again, to rediscover their brotherly bond and embark on the most important adventure of their lives.”

Adventure Time: Distant Lands is set to release in 2020, and it seems the episodes’ release will be staggered. ‘BMO’ and ‘Obsidian’ will be released first, followed by ‘Wizard City’ and ‘Together Again’ sometime later.

The new streaming service HBO Max is scheduled for release in spring 2020.
